    North Cascades National Park Complex Headquarters is located in Sedro-Woolley, Washington, United States of America. Situated within the North Cascades mountain range, the headquarters serves as the administrative center for the national park complex.

  • Cascade Pass

    Cascade Pass is a popular hiking route known for its breathtaking views of jagged peaks, glaciers, and wildflowers. The trail is a gateway to the alpine wonders of North Cascades National Park.
  • Diablo Lake

    Diablo Lake is a stunning turquoise reservoir nestled amidst the mountains. Its vibrant color, resulting from glacial sediment, offers a scenic backdrop for activities like boating, kayaking, and fishing.
  • Stehekin Valley

    Stehekin Valley is a remote and picturesque valley located on the shores of Lake Chelan. Accessible by boat or floatplane, it offers a peaceful retreat and opportunities for hiking, biking, fishing, and immersing in nature.
